在网站建设与维护过程中,常常会遇到各种技术问题。其中,“asp文件的网站首页找不到”是一个常见且需要迅速解决的技术难题。本文将针对这一问题,从问题诊断、原因分析到解决方案进行详细阐述,帮助网站管理员快速定位并解决首页无法访问的问题。
问题诊断
当用户访问网站时,如果发现网站首页无法加载或显示,首先需要进行问题诊断。这包括检查网站的服务器状态、网络连接以及具体的文件路径等。如果确定问题是出在asp文件上,那么就需要进一步分析原因。
原因分析
1. 文件路径错误:网站首页的ASP文件路径可能设置错误,导致服务器无法找到该文件。
2. 文件损坏:ASP文件可能因服务器故障或不当操作导致损坏,无法正常执行。
3. 服务器配置问题:服务器的IIS(Internet Information Services)配置不当,可能导致ASP文件无法正确解析或执行。
4. 权限问题:文件或目录权限设置不当,导致服务器无法读取ASP文件。
解决方案
1. 检查文件路径:确认ASP文件的实际路径是否与网站设置中的路径一致。如不一致,需要修改网站配置文件中的路径设置。
2. 文件修复与备份:如果ASP文件损坏,可以尝试从备份中恢复文件。如无备份,需要重新编写或修复文件。
3. 检查服务器配置:确保IIS配置正确,支持ASP文件的解析与执行。如有需要,可以咨询服务器管理员或专业人士进行配置调整。
4. 检查权限设置:确保网站目录和文件的权限设置正确,允许服务器读取和执行ASP文件。
5. 查看错误日志:查看服务器的错误日志,寻找与ASP文件相关的错误信息,进一步定位问题原因。
6. 代码检查:如果问题涉及ASP代码本身的问题,需要对代码进行仔细检查,修复错误或重新编写代码。
7. 联系技术支持:如以上方法均无法解决问题,可以联系网站的技术支持团队或专业人士寻求帮助。
预防措施
1. 定期备份:定期对网站文件进行备份,以防文件损坏或丢失导致的问题。
2. 监控与维护:定期监控服务器的运行状态和网站的运行情况,及时发现并解决问题。
3. 安全防护:加强网站的安全防护措施,防止恶意攻击和破坏导致的问题。
4. 培训与学习:定期对网站管理员进行技术培训和知识学习,提高其处理问题的能力。
“asp文件的网站首页找不到”是一个常见的技术问题,但通过仔细的问题诊断、原因分析和解决方案的实施,可以快速解决这一问题。在解决问题的过程中,还需要注意预防措施的实施,以避免类似问题的再次发生。希望本文的解决方案能对网站管理员有所帮助。